Speed limit for vans on dual carriageways to be increased to 70mph.

Petition Details

Car derived vans and van derived motor homes and so called sport vans can drive at 70 mph on dual carriageways yet vans such as Ford Transit or Mercedes Sprinters are restricted to 60mph. This is endorsable by 3 penalty points and a fine. For what reason?

Additional Information

An old man who drives his van derived motor home occasionally can drive at 70 whilst a professional driver doing a purpose built vehicle becomes a target for traffic police and speed cameras.
